Threatmate, Inc. is a other technology company based in Dover, Delaware, incorporated in 2021. It has reported $6.3 million raised across 3 Form D filings with the SEC, most recently in 2025.

ThreatMate identifies exploitable risk for MSPs—attack surface discovery, vulnerability scanning, automated pentesting, and configuration audits.

Form D is the notice a company files with the SEC when it sells securities without registering them. It reports the amount sold, not a valuation. Figures here are what the filing says.
